免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

如何使用html5做app页面

HTML5是一种被广泛使用的标准,用于构建跨平台应用程序和网站。相对于旧版本的HTML,HTML5提供更多的新特性和API,使得开发者可以更加轻松地创建优秀的应用程序。接下来,我将详细介绍如何使用HTML5来创建一个APP页面。

HTML5提供的新特性:

1. 语义化元素

2. 表单控件

3. 多媒体元素

4. 新的Canvas元素

5. Web存储和数据库API

6. 全屏API

7. 地理位置API

8. Web Workers和Web Sockets

下面我们来看一下如何应用这些新特性来创造一个APP页面。

第一步:定义页面结构

使用HTML 5语义化标签为页面结构定义所需的元素。在APP开发中,一个常见的页面结构包括标题,导航菜单,内容和页脚。其中,导航菜单通常包括“主页”,“浏览”,“搜索”,“设置”等功能链接。结构示例代码如下:

```

My App

My App

欢迎来到 My App

这里是 My App 的主页,欢迎您的光临。

© 2021 My App. All rights reserved.

```

第二步:使用CSS进行样式设计

使用CSS对页面进行风格设计。在APP开发中,我们希望页面看起来具有现代感,用户友好和易于导航,因此我们需要使用CSS来实现以下任务:

1. 指定颜色,字体大小和行高

2. 定义页面布局

3. 指定导航样式

4. 将内容格式化为虚拟应用程序

5. 定义页面背景和背景图像

示例代码如下:

```

/* 全局CSS */

body {

font-family: Arial, sans-serif;

font-size: 16px;

line-height: 1.5;

color: #333;

background: #eee;

}

/* Header */

header {

padding: 20px;

background: #3498db;

color: #fff;

}

/* Navigation */

nav {

display: flex;

justify-content: space-between;

align-items: center;

padding: 10px;

background: #555;

color: #fff;

}

nav ul {

display: flex;

list-style: none;

}

nav ul li {

margin-right: 20px;

}

nav ul li a {

color: #fff;

text-decoration: none;

}

nav ul li a:hover {

color: #3498db;

}

/* Content */

section {

margin: 20px;

padding: 20px;

background: #fff;

box-shadow: 0 2px 5px rgba(0,0,0,0.3);

}

/* Footer */

footer {

padding: 20px;

background: #555;

color: #fff;

}

```

第三步:使用JavaScript添加交互

使用JavaScript对页面添加交互。我们可以使用HTML5提供的API来处理用户输入,存储数据,显示通知等。例如,如果用户点击“搜索”按钮,我们可以使用JavaScript打开搜索框并执行搜索功能。示例代码如下:

```

/* 全局CSS */

body {

font-family: Arial, sans-serif;

font-size: 16px;

line-height: 1.5;

color: #333;

background: #eee;

}

/* Header */

header {

padding: 20px;

background: #3498db;

color: #fff;

}

/* Navigation */

nav {

display: flex;

justify-content: space-between;

align-items: center;

padding: 10px;

background: #555;

color: #fff;

}

nav ul {

display: flex;

list-style: none;

}

nav ul li {

margin-right: 20px;

}

nav ul li a {

color: #fff;

text-decoration: none;

}

nav ul li a:hover {

color: #3498db;

}

/* Content */

section {

margin: 20px;

padding: 20px;

background: #fff;

box-shadow: 0 2px 5px rgba(0,0,0,0.3);

}

/* Footer */

footer {

padding: 20px;

background: #555;

color: #fff;

}

/* JavaScript */

let searchBtn = document.querySelector("#search-btn");

let searchBox = document.querySelector("#search-box");

searchBtn.addEventListener("click", function() {

searchBox.style.display = "block";

});

```

通过以上步骤,您现在已经能够创建一个基本的HTML5应用程序页面了。您可以根据您的需求和应用程序的功能来添加更多的功能和特性。


相关知识:
做网站的app哪个好
在移动互联网时代,手机已经成为人们不可或缺的日常工具,而APP的推出更是让人们在手机上完成各种操作变得更加便捷快速,特别是网站也推出了很多与之配套的APP设计,如何实现网站的APP呢?下面本文将为大家介绍几款实现网站的APP的好工具。 一、HBuilder
2023-05-18
怎么把小说网站做成书源导入阅读app
随着智能手机和平板电脑的普及,电子阅读已经成为了现代人们重要的阅读方式。而阅读app则是这一领域的重要载体。阅读app一般会整合多个书源,让用户可以方便地搜索和读取自己喜欢的小说。那么,如何把小说网站做成书源导入阅读app呢?下面就来介绍一下具体的方法。一
2023-05-18
怎样做app网站
要制作一个app网站,需要遵循以下几个步骤:1. 确定网站类型和功能首先,需要确定网站的类型和功能。比如,是一款学习类的app网站,还是一款购物类的app网站,或者是提供服务类的app网站等等。在确定网站类型和功能后,需要制作网站的草图和结构图,以便更好地
2023-05-18
网站封装成app可以做热更新
随着移动应用市场的不断发展,更多的开发者开始关注移动应用的热更新。这是一种重要的更新方式,可以让应用快速地对问题进行修复和改进,同时降低用户卸载应用的可能性。那么,如何将网站封装成app实现热更新呢?下面将介绍该过程的原理和详细步骤。原理:将网站封装成应用
2023-05-18
什么app做网页好用又清晰
App是仅用于移动设备的应用程序,可以在移动设备上运行,以便用户能够轻松地使用移动设备进行各种操作。随着移动设备的普及,越来越多的人需要使用移动设备来访问网页,这是非常方便的。然而,如果要在移动设备上创建或编辑网页,就需要一个适合移动设备的好的app。本文
2023-05-18
使用vue做app需要会什么
Vue是一种用于构建用户界面的JavaScript框架,它使用MVVM模式,以实现组件化开发和数据绑定。它非常适合开发Web应用程序以及移动应用程序,而且拥有非常灵活的API,VUE的优点包括高效、易于学习和扩展。如果您想使用Vue构建移动应用程序,您需要
2023-05-18
前端做手机app
随着移动设备越来越流行,越来越多的网站和应用程序开始采用响应式设计或原生移动应用程序来提高其可用性和整体用户体验。前端开发也随之发展了许多新技术和方法,也引出了一些新问题。做手机App也是前端开发人员经常面对的一个挑战,那么如何通过前端技术来实现一个手机A
2023-05-18
能把网页做成应用的app
在现在互联网快速发展的时代,越来越多的网站和应用程序被用于各种各样的用途。然而,对于许多人来说,将网页转换为应用程序似乎是一种神秘和令人讨厌的过程。但实际上,将网页转换为应用程序是一项相对简单的任务,只需要一些基本的技能和工具。下面我为您介绍将网页转换为应
2023-05-18
vue可以做app吗
Vue是一种流行的JavaScript框架,用于开发Web应用程序。Vue框架非常适合用于创建单页应用程序(SPA),因为它使处理视图和数据变得轻松简单。虽然Vue用于开发Web应用程序比较常见,但是Vue也可以用于构建移动应用程序。本篇文章将介绍Vue如
2023-05-18
php做app接口时
在移动应用开发中,很多应用都需要通过后台接口获取数据。PHP作为一种脚本语言,在快速搭建后台接口方面有着很好的表现。下面我们就来介绍PHP如何实现移动应用的后台接口。1. 建立数据库首先,我们需要在自己的Web服务器上搭建数据库。可以使用MySQL、SQL
2023-05-18
java网页怎么做成app
Java是当前最流行的编程语言之一,在Web应用和移动应用开发方面也有着广泛的应用。很多Java Web应用都想将其转化为手机应用程序,以便更好的满足用户需求,那么Java网页如何转化为手机应用程序呢?这需要涉及到一些原理和技术,下面就对这一过程进行具体介
2023-05-18
app前端开发是做什么
APP前端开发是一项复杂的技术,它可以实现各种各样的功能和呈现效果。在这个数字化时代,APP前端开发已成为一个越来越重要的技术领域。它是指通过HTML、CSS、JavaScript等技术开发出APP的界面和用户交互效果。那么,APP前端开发到底是做什么呢?
2023-05-18
©2015-2021 智电瑞创 蜀ICP备17039183号